// Copyright (c) 2012 The Chromium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#include "ui/views/corewm/input_method_event_filter.h"
#include "ui/aura/client/aura_constants.h"
#include "ui/aura/root_window.h"
#include "ui/base/events/event.h"
#include "ui/base/ime/input_method.h"
#include "ui/base/ime/input_method_factory.h"
namespace views {
namespace corewm {
////////////////////////////////////////////////////////////////////////////////
// InputMethodEventFilter, public:
InputMethodEventFilter::InputMethodEventFilter(gfx::AcceleratedWidget widget)
: input_method_(ui::CreateInputMethod(this, widget)),
target_root_window_(NULL) {
// TODO(yusukes): Check if the root window is currently focused and pass the
// result to Init().
input_method_->Init(true);
}
InputMethodEventFilter::~InputMethodEventFilter() {
}
void InputMethodEventFilter::SetInputMethodPropertyInRootWindow(
aura::RootWindow* root_window) {
root_window->SetProperty(aura::client::kRootWindowInputMethodKey,
input_method_.get());
}
////////////////////////////////////////////////////////////////////////////////
// InputMethodEventFilter, EventFilter implementation:
void InputMethodEventFilter::OnKeyEvent(ui::KeyEvent* event) {
const ui::EventType type = event->type();
if (type == ui::ET_TRANSLATED_KEY_PRESS ||
type == ui::ET_TRANSLATED_KEY_RELEASE) {
// The |event| is already handled by this object, change the type of the
// event to ui::ET_KEY_* and pass it to the next filter.
static_cast<ui::TranslatedKeyEvent*>(event)->ConvertToKeyEvent();
} else {
// If the focused window is changed, all requests to IME will be
// discarded so it's safe to update the target_root_window_ here.
aura::Window* target = static_cast<aura::Window*>(event->target());
target_root_window_ = target->GetRootWindow();
DCHECK(target_root_window_);
bool handled = false;
if (event->HasNativeEvent())
handled = input_method_->DispatchKeyEvent(event->native_event());
else
handled = input_method_->DispatchFabricatedKeyEvent(*event);
if (handled)
event->StopPropagation();
}
}
////////////////////////////////////////////////////////////////////////////////
// InputMethodEventFilter, ui::InputMethodDelegate implementation:
bool InputMethodEventFilter::DispatchKeyEventPostIME(
const base::NativeEvent& event) {
#if defined(OS_WIN)
DCHECK(event.message != WM_CHAR);
#endif
ui::TranslatedKeyEvent aura_event(event, false /* is_char */);
return target_root_window_->AsRootWindowHostDelegate()->OnHostKeyEvent(
&aura_event);
}
bool InputMethodEventFilter::DispatchFabricatedKeyEventPostIME(
ui::EventType type,
ui::KeyboardCode key_code,
int flags) {
ui::TranslatedKeyEvent aura_event(type == ui::ET_KEY_PRESSED, key_code,
flags);
return target_root_window_->AsRootWindowHostDelegate()->OnHostKeyEvent(
&aura_event);
}
} // namespace corewm
} // namespace views
